In recent years, the healthcare landscape of Bangladesh has witnessed a transformative shift with the integration of digital solutions, particularly the rise of the Online doctor appointment in Bangladesh. This innovation has not only improved patient convenience but also bridged the gap between rural communities and urban medical professionals. As internet penetration and smartphone usage increase in the country, online medical services have become more accessible, affordable, and efficient than ever before.
The Growing Need for Digital Healthcare in BangladeshBangladesh, with a population exceeding 170 million, faces challenges in ensuring quality healthcare for all. Urban areas, especially Dhaka and Chattogram, are densely populated with hospitals and specialists, while rural regions often struggle with limited access to experienced doctors and medical facilities. This urban-rural disparity in healthcare access has long been a concern.
To tackle this, digital health services have emerged as a vital tool. Online doctor appointments allow patients to connect with healthcare professionals remotely, reducing travel time, cost, and waiting lines at crowded clinics. This system is particularly valuable during emergencies, lockdowns, or when individuals require quick consultations without the hassle of physical travel.
How Online Doctor Appointment WorksThe process of booking an online doctor appointment in Bangladesh is straightforward and user-friendly. Several platforms, including Doctorola, Arogga, Maya, BDDoctor24, and Practo Bangladesh, have developed apps and websites where users can:
Search for doctors by specialty, location, availability, or language preference.
View doctor profiles, qualifications, reviews, consultation fees, and schedules.
Book appointments for either online (video/audio chat) or offline (in-person) consultations.
Receive e-prescriptions, follow-up reminders, and lab test suggestions.
Make payments online using mobile wallets like bKash, Nagad, or bank transfers.
This digital process has simplified healthcare access and empowered patients to take control of their health more efficiently.
Benefits of Online Doctor Appointments in BangladeshOne of the most significant advantages of online doctor appointments is time and cost efficiency. Patients no longer have to wait in long queues or travel long distances for minor ailments or follow-ups. This is especially beneficial for elderly patients, pregnant women, and those with chronic illnesses who require frequent consultations.
Another major benefit is access to specialist care, regardless of geographical limitations. For example, a patient in a remote village of Rangpur can consult a cardiologist based in Dhaka without needing to travel to the capital. This level of access was unimaginable a decade ago.
Furthermore, online platforms often offer 24/7 availability, allowing patients to get consultations during emergencies or odd hours. This continuous support contributes significantly to better patient outcomes and healthcare satisfaction.
Online Platforms Leading the ChangeSeveral startups and companies in Bangladesh are leading the revolution in telemedicine and digital healthcare:
Doctorola: One of the pioneers in this space, Doctorola allows users to find and book appointments with doctors from reputed hospitals.
Arogga: While mainly a medicine delivery platform, Arogga has also started offering online consultations, enabling users to get prescriptions and refills conveniently.
Maya: Maya is a unique platform offering anonymous health advice via chat. It covers mental health, gynecology, general health, and even legal issues.
BDDoctor24: A fast-growing app-based platform offering both online and in-person appointment services.
Tonic (by Grameenphone): Tonic provides subscribers access to doctors via phone calls and chats, promoting affordable healthcare solutions.
These platforms have played a critical role in democratizing healthcare in Bangladesh, making it accessible not only to the tech-savvy urban youth but also to rural communities with basic smartphone access.
Challenges and LimitationsDespite its numerous advantages, the online doctor appointment in Bangladesh faces several challenges. Firstly, digital literacy remains a barrier, particularly among older adults or people in rural areas who may find it difficult to navigate apps or websites.
Secondly, internet connectivity can be unreliable in some regions, affecting the quality of video consultations. Inconsistent power supply and low-speed mobile data services may interrupt communication between doctors and patients.
Another challenge is the lack of regulations and standardization. While many platforms are working hard to maintain quality, the absence of strict government guidelines means there’s a risk of unqualified individuals offering services. Ensuring patient data privacy and protecting against fraud are also major concerns that need to be addressed.
Government Support and Future ProspectsThe Government of Bangladesh has shown increasing interest in digitizing healthcare services. Initiatives like Digital Bangladesh Vision 2021 have already laid the groundwork for this transformation. The Ministry of Health and Family Welfare has partnered with various organizations to set up community clinics and telemedicine centers, especially in rural regions.
In addition, COVID-19 further accelerated the adoption of online health services. During the pandemic, the government launched telemedicine hotlines and encouraged the use of digital health platforms to reduce the pressure on hospitals. These steps have set a strong precedent for the integration of online healthcare in the public health infrastructure.
The future of online doctor appointments in Bangladesh looks promising. With the expansion of 4G and upcoming 5G networks, better internet access will make video consultations smoother. The integration of AI-based health assistants, remote patient monitoring tools, and electronic health records (EHR) will further enhance the quality of care.
Cultural Shift and Patient AwarenessFor the long-term success of online doctor appointments, public awareness and trust in digital healthcare systems are vital. Many people still prefer face-to-face consultations due to cultural habits or lack of trust in remote diagnoses. Educating patients about the safety, reliability, and convenience of online consultations is crucial.
Efforts should also be made to train doctors on how to effectively use digital tools and communicate with patients remotely. As more healthcare professionals adopt telemedicine, the system will naturally become more integrated and effective.
